Driven by Tradition, Tzedakah and Tikkun Olam, United Israel Appeal’s Women’s Division promotes Jewish women’s dedication to the survival, continuity and connection to Israel and the Jewish people. Through this Division, women in Melbourne can learn more about the needs of Israel and why they should donate to UIA.
We are currently working to build a small committee of women who are dedicated to strengthening the Victorian Women’s Division campaign. The committee will plan our annual campaign opening events, organize our annual pinning ceremonies where our major donors are recognized, and consider creative fundraising strategies to engage and involve a new generation of women in supporting the State of Israel. The Women’s Division is also considering repeating the successful Mission to Israel that was conducted in 2007 which took approximately 20 women to Israel where they saw the projects and initiatives supported by KH-UIA. ALWAYS BE A LEADER, NOT A FOLLOWERYoung UIA hosted a successful Major Donor Boardroom Lunch on Friday 19 June at the offices of Deutsche Bank in the CBD. Over 70 people heard special guest speaker Lindsay Fox relay his life history and work ethic. Fox mentioned that to be successful, “you have to be a leader, be upfront and ahead of everyone else. Anyone can be a follower and you will fall behind if you become a follower”. Fox also engaged the crowd by talking about his family history and connection to the Melbourne Jewish community.
PERSISTENCE IS THE KEY TO ANY SUCCESSJohn Gandel AO addressed an audience of Young UIA Major Donors at a boardroom lunch hosted by Deutsche Bank on Wednesday 19 August. Gandel relayed the 3 principals he lives by which has led to his success. The first is to seize the moment. Second, is the recognition of an unusual opportunity and the final one is to action a carefully thought out plan. He also discussed the importance of philanthropy, whether through giving or working for a cause. It is something that makes you feel good and gives you a sense of gratification. He emphasized the importance of supporting the UIA as a means for connecting to Israel and the Jewish community.

Partnership 2000 recently welcomed a delegation of 15 Year 10 students and a teacher from the Shitt im School in the Arava Region. After a week in Sydney, the students were hosted by Bialik College families in Melbourne. Students attended classes and participated in education programs at the Jewish Day Schools. They also enjoyed sightseeing in and around Melbourne. Partnership 2000 continues to strengthen the connection between the Australian Jewish community and the people of the central Arava region.
